Application of Pressure Relief Technology of Liquid CO2 Fracturing Roadway in Tingnan Coal Mine

Abstract: In order to eliminate the potential safety problems of rockburst in Tingnan coal mine, liquid CO2 fracturing technology is adopted for pre-splitting blasting in hazardous areas. Through numerical simulation, effect of the control hole on the drilling blasting and the reasonable spacing of blasting hole in Tingnan coal mine are investigated, and the blasting performance is analyzed by the method of drilling bits. The results show that the control hole is favorable for the coal blasting, and the influence scope of crack area of the liquid CO2 blasting with control hole is significantly larger than that without blasting hole. The reasonable spacing of blasting hole in Tingnan coal mine is 7 m; After blasting, the measured amounts of drilling and cuttings are less than the critical values. The hidden danger of rock burst in coal blocks can be eliminated through blasting to realize normal mining.
